The exact last date for the application process is not available. However, based on recent years, it is known that the ANU usually concludes the application process for ANUEET between June and July of every year.

The application fee for ANUEET exam through which candidates are selected for BTech courses, is INR 1,200 (INR 1,000 for reserved categories). Students must note that this fee is taken from official sources. However, it is subject to change.
